The exact list of fees and charges for buying gold with a credit card will depend on the exact dealer you use to make your purchase. It’s common for dealers to charge a processing fee of 3%-4% if you use a credit card to buy gold. The short answer is, technically, you can’t really buy stocks using a credit card. Brokerage firms want you to deposit money in your brokerage account in other ways, such as via check, bank transfer, or wire transfer.
